coyotillo

Noun — A low rhamnaceous shrub (Karwinskia humboldtiana) of the southwestern United States and Mexico, with poisonous berries.

Etymology

From Spanish coyotillo; diminutive of coyote, which is able to eat its poisonous fruit without harm.
